Planting Calendar for Elephant Ears

Frost tolerance for elephant ears: Not tolerant of frost.
When to plant: After the last frost.

You really shouldn't plant elephant ears until after all chance of frost has passed because they are not cold tolerant.

The earliest that you can plant elephant ears in Monroe is April. However, you really should wait until May if you don't want to take any chances.

The last month that you can plant elephant ears and expect a good harvest is probably August. If you wait any later than that and your elephant ears may not have a chance to grow to maturity. You can get started a little bit earlier by starting your elephant ears indoors.

Last Frost Date

The average date of last frost is April 15 in Monroe. In the coldest months of winter you can expect an average low temperature of 5°F.

Keep in mind that USDA zone info for Monroe is not always accurate and the actual date of last frost will vary from year to year. Half of the time in Monroe last frost occurs after April 15 so make sure that you are prepared to protect your elephant ears if you have a late frost.

USDA Zone Info for Monroe

Here is the info for USDA Zone 7b.

Average Date of Last Frost (spring)April 15
Average Date of First Frost (fall)October 15
Lowest Expected Low5°F
Highest Expected Low10°F

This means that on a really cold year, the coldest it will get is 5°F. On most years you should be prepared to experience lows near 10°F.
